
Alex Veilleux contributed to the coveo/platform-client repository by delivering two targeted features focused on extensibility and maintainability. In TypeScript, Alex enhanced the SourceModel interface to support per-document configuration through an optional documentConfig field, enabling more flexible document processing while preserving backward compatibility. Additionally, Alex expanded the platform’s data ingestion capabilities by introducing a Shopify data source type within the Enums.ts file, laying the groundwork for future Shopify integration. The work demonstrated careful interface definition and enum management, with a clear emphasis on backward-compatible improvements and code quality, providing a solid foundation for future enhancements without introducing breaking changes.

October 2025 — coveo/platform-client: Delivered the Shopify data source option groundwork, preparing integration with Shopify as a data source. No major bug fixes were recorded this month; all work focused on expanding data ingestion capabilities and maintaining a clean, extensible codebase.
October 2025 — coveo/platform-client: Delivered the Shopify data source option groundwork, preparing integration with Shopify as a data source. No major bug fixes were recorded this month; all work focused on expanding data ingestion capabilities and maintaining a clean, extensible codebase.
February 2025 monthly summary for coveo/platform-client focusing on feature delivery, backward-compatible improvements, and maintainability. Work concentrated on enhancing configurability for document processing while preserving existing behavior.
February 2025 monthly summary for coveo/platform-client focusing on feature delivery, backward-compatible improvements, and maintainability. Work concentrated on enhancing configurability for document processing while preserving existing behavior.
Overview of all repositories you've contributed to across your timeline